A very misleading report appeared yesterday in Independant Newspaper publications and on their websites, suggesting that all employers with more then 100 loans to employees would have to register with the National Credit Regulator.
We wish to clarify the issue with our opinion on this matter. With due respect to Ms. Patten or the author of the article, it fails to specify that such loans would only fall under the National Credit Act if interest were charged, if not it would fall outside the Act and no registration would be required.
